A pharmaceutical formulation comprising amoxycillin and clavulanate in a ratio of n: 1 where n is a number from 1 to 16 which comprises: a first set of granulates comprising amoxycillin and clavulanate in a ratio from 1:1 or 2:1; and a second set of granulates comprising amoxycillin and no clavulanate; providing to give an overall ratio between amoxycillin and clavulanate of n: 1, wherein the formulation when in the form of a tablet comprises the first and the second sets of granulates in a mixture. 2. A formulation as claimed in claim 1 in which n is 2, 4, 6, 7, 8, 14 or 16. 3. A formulation as claimed in claims 1 or 2 in which amoxycillin is present as amoxycillin trihydrate. 4. A formulation as claimed in any one of claims 1 to 3 in which clavulanate is present as potassium clavulanate. 5. A formulation as claimed in any one of claims 1 to 4 in which the granulates comprises an intragranular disintegrant in an amount from 1,25 to 3,5% by the granulate weight. 6. A formulation as claimed in any one of claims 1 to 5 in which the first set of granulates further comprises intragranular disintegrant as a silica gel in an amount from 5 to 25% by the clavulanate weight. 7. A formulation as claimed in any one of claims 1 to 6 in which the first set of granulates consist essentially of amoxycillin, potassium clavulanate, silica gel and an intragranular disintegrant. 8. A formulation as claimed in any one of claims 1 to 6 in which the second set of granulates consist essentially of amoxycillin and an intragranular disintegrant. 9. A formulation as claimed in any one of claims 5 to 8 in which the intragranular disintegrant is cross-linked N-vinyl-2-pyrrolidone or sodium starch glycollate. 10. A formulation as claimed in any one of claims 1 to 9 in the form of a tablet. 11. A formulation as claimed in claim 10 further comprising an extragranular excipient which is low-substituted hydroxyproylcellulose. 12. A formulation as claimed in claim 10 or 11 in which the combined weight of all excipients is less than 20% of the uncoated core weight of the tablet. 13. A formulation as claimed in claim 10, which comprises: amoxycillin granulates which consist essentially of amoxycillin trihydrate present in about 97wt% and CLPVP present in about 3wt%; amoxycillin and potassium clavulanate granulates which comprise a 2:1 ratio of amoxycillin to clavulanate, silica gel present in about 10 wt% of potassium clavulanate and about 3wt% of CLPVP; and extragranular excipients selected from the group including silica gel; low-substituted hydroxypropylcellulose or CLPVP; colloidal silica and magnesium stearate. 14. A formualtion as claimed in claim 12 in which the tablet cores have the weights: 500/125mg - 800 to 850mg; and 875/125mg - 1250 to 1350mg. 15. A formulation as claimed in any one of claims 1 to 9 in the form of a sachet or a powder for reconstitution as an aqueous syrup. 16. A process for preparing a formulation according to any one of the preceding claims which comprises blending together a first set of granulates comprising amoxycillin and clavulanate with a second set of granulates comprising amoxycillin and no clavulanate in an appropriate ratio with other excipients and then, if necessary and desired, further processing the blend to obtain the final desired formulation. 17. A process as claimed in claim 16 which comprises the preliminary step of preparing the first and/or second set of granulates by roller compaction. 18. A granulate comprising amoxycillin trihydrate and potassium clavulanate in a ratio of 1:1, 2:1 or 4:1, wherein this ratio refers to the weight of parent compound amoxycillin or clavulanic acid, and an intragranular diluent present in from 5 to 25% by weight of potassium clavulanate. 2. A granulate as claimed in claim 1 wherein the intragranular diluent is present from 5 to 15% by weight of potassium clavulanate. 3. A granulate as claimed in claim 1 or 2 wherein the intragranular diluent is silica gel. 4. A granulate as claimed in any of claims 1 to 3 which further comprises an intragranular disintegrant present in from 1.25 to 3.5% by weight of the granulate. 5. A granulate as claimed in claim 4 wherein the intragranular disintegrant is sodium starch glycollate or cross-linked N-vinyl-2-pyrrolidinone. 6. A granulate as claimed in any of claims 1 to 5 which further comprises an intragranular lubricant present in from 0 to 0.35% by weight of the granulate. 7. A granulate as claimed in claim 6 wherein the intragranular lubricant is magnesium stearate. 8. A granulate as claimed in any of claims 1 to 7 wherein the equilibrium relative humidity of the amoxycillin trihydrate is from 10 to 20%. 9. A pharmaceutical formulation comprising granulates as defined in any of claims 1 to 8 and granulates comprising amoxycillin trihydrate (and no clavulanate) such that the overall ratio of amoxycillin trihydrate to potassium clavulanate is in a ratio of n: 1 where n is a number from 2 to16 and the ratio refers to the weight of parent compound amoxycillin or clavulanic acid. 10. A formulation as claimed in claim 9 wherein the overall ratio of amoxycillin trihydrate to potassium clavulanate is selected from 2:1, 4:1, 6:1, 7:1, 8:1 or 14:1 and the ratio refers to the weight of parent compound amoxycillin or clavulanic acid. 11. A formulation as claimed in claims 9 or 10 further comprising an extra-granular dessicant present in an amount up to 5% by weight of the formulation. 12. A formulation as claimed in claim 11 wherein the extra-granular dessicant is silica gel. 13. A formulation as claimed in any of claims 9 to 12 comprising amoxycillin trihydrate and potassium clavulanate in a ratio of n:1, where n is a number from 2 to 16 and the ratio refers to the weight of parent compound amoxycillin or clavulanic acid, and which comprises granulates consisting essentially of amoxycillin trihydrate and potassium clavulanate, cross-linked N-vinyl-2-pyrrolidinone (as an intragranular disintegrant) present in about 3wt% of amoxycillin trihydrate and silica gel (as an intragranular diluent/dessicant) present in about 10wt% of potassium clavulanate. 14.
